Latest Patents

James M Thomas holds a patent for a "Method of Thin Strip Casting." This invention involves an apparatus designed for continuous casting of a metal strip while effectively reducing defects known as snake eggs in the metal strip. The apparatus features a pair of counter-rotating casting rolls that allow for the casting of a thin strip. A metal delivery system is positioned above the nip to discharge molten metal into a casting pool supported on the rolls. Additionally, the design includes tapered side dam holders and side dams that confine the casting pool of molten metal. An oscillation mechanism provides lateral oscillation to each side dam and holder during the casting process, enhancing the quality of the final product.
